🕊️ Cultural & Spiritual Significance

Cultural Impact

The name Sadegh holds a significant cultural impact in the Islamic world, particularly among the Shia Muslims. It is an honorary title given to a person who is considered a truthful and righteous leader, guide, or a scholar. The title Sadegh is often used as a prefix to the names of great religious leaders and scholars, such as Sadegh Hormuzi Shushtari and Sadegh Shirazi, who have left an indelible mark on Islamic history with their contributions to Islamic scholarship, jurisprudence, and spirituality.
